Melatonin and B6
my sister who is a nutritionist suggested i take b6 and melatonin for dreaming. i didnt ask much about it because i wasnt interested about dreaming at the time. but my question is if i'm supposed to take both before i goto bed? are there any side effects to melatonin or b6?
-
If you take too much B6 (like 1000mg) you can get nerve damage, but 200mg a night is probably harmless and does give many people more vivid dreams.

DROM:
The answer is yes, about an hour before bedtime.
As for lucidity, that part is up to you. There IS no pill that will make you lucid. All these dream aids do is enhance your dream quality; the more intense the better, but you still have to remember to recognize in the dream that you are dreaming.
